
The Golden Age of Advertising by Jim Heimann
With the consumerist euphoria of the fifties going strong and the race to the moon at its height, the mood of advertising in the sixties was cheerful, optimistic, and at times, revolutionary. Featuring ads from the space age, this colorful collection of print ads explores the world of 60s Americana.
The editor: Jim Heimann is a resident of Los Angeles, a graphic designer, writer, historian, and instructor at Art Center College of Design in Pasadena, California. He is Executive Editor for TASCHEN America and the author of numerous books on architecture, popular culture, and Hollywood history.
